fledgeless

 

Definitions from WordNet

Adjective fledgeless has 1 sense
  1. unfledged, fledgeless, unvaned - (of an arrow) not equipped with feathers; "shot an unfledged arrow"
    Antonym: feathered (indirect, via unfeathered)

fledgeless

Part of Speech: Adjective

- Fledgeless refers to something or someone that lacks feathers, specifically in reference to birds that have not yet developed feathers for flight. It can also be used figuratively to describe a person or entity as incomplete or lacking essential qualities.

Example Sentences:

1. The fledgeless chicks chirped anxiously in their nest, waiting for their feathers to grow.

2. She felt fledgeless without her mentor's guidance, unsure of how to navigate the unfamiliar territory.
